Цвета в Excel: полное руководство от базовой заливки до профессионального дизайна таблиц

Цвет в Microsoft Excel — это не просто украшение, а мощный инструмент визуализации данных. Правильно подобранная палитра помогает выделить ключевые показатели, упрощает восприятие отчётов и делает таблицы профессиональными. Но многие пользователи ограничиваются базовой заливкой ячеек, даже не подозревая о скрытых возможностях программы.

В этой статье вы узнаете не только как покрасить ячейку в Excel стандартными методами, но и как работать с условным форматированием по цветам, создавать градиенты, настраивать тематические палитры и даже автоматизировать окраску с помощью формул. Мы разберём типичные ошибки (например, почему цвета печатаются не так, как на экране) и дадим практические советы для работы с большими массивами данных.

Материал будет полезен как новичкам, так и опытным пользователям: первые научатся основам, вторые откроют для себя продвинутые техники, которые экономят часы рутинной работы. Все инструкции актуальны для Excel 2019–2023 и Microsoft 365, с пометками о различиях в старых версиях.

1. Базовая заливка ячеек: 3 способа изменить цвет

Начнём с азов — как закрасить ячейку в Excel или диапазон. Эти методы работают во всех версиях программы и подходят для быстрого оформления таблиц.

Самый очевидный способ — использовать кнопку Цвет заливки на главной вкладке. Но есть и менее известные приёмы:

  • 🎨 Горячие клавиши: выделите ячейки и нажмите Alt → H → H (поочерёдно), затем выберите цвет стрелками. Это в 2 раза быстрее, чем мышкой.
  • 🖌️ Кисть форматирования: после заливки одной ячейки дважды кликните по инструменту Формат по образцу (на вкладке Главная), чтобы перенести цвет на другие ячейки.
  • 📋 Контекстное меню: правый клик по ячейке → Формат ячеек → вкладка Заливка. Здесь можно выбрать не только цвет, но и узор (например, сетку или точки).

Важно: если вы копируете ячейки с цветом (Ctrl+CCtrl+V), Excel по умолчанию сохраняет и форматирование. Чтобы вставить только значения, используйте Специальная вставка (Ctrl+Alt+V) и выберите Значения.

⚠️ Внимание: В Excel 2010 и старше палитра цветов ограничена 56 оттенками. Если вам нужны дополнительные цвета, нажмите Другие цветаОпределить цвет и введите HEX-код (например, #4F81BD для корпоративного синего).
📊 Какой способ заливки используете чаще?
Кнопка "Цвет заливки"
Горячие клавиши
Кисть форматирования
Контекстное меню

2. Условное форматирование по цветам: автоматизация окраски

Условное форматирование позволяет автоматически менять цвет ячеек в зависимости от их значений. Это незаменимо для выделения просроченных задач, отклонений от плана или топовых продаж.

Как настроить:

  1. Выделите диапазон (например, A1:A100).
  2. Перейдите на вкладку ГлавнаяУсловное форматированиеПравила выделения ячеек.
  3. Выберите условие (например, Больше чем) и введите пороговое значение.
  4. Задайте цвет заливки и шрифта.

Продвинутый вариант — использование формул в условном форматировании. Например, чтобы выделить дубликаты в столбце B, создайте правило с формулой:

=СЧЁТЕСЛИ($B$1:$B$100; B1)>1

И выберите красный цвет заливки. Теперь все повторяющиеся значения будут подсвечены автоматически.

Выделить диапазон данных|Выбрать тип правила (больше/меньше/между и т.д.)|Задать пороговые значения|Настроить стиль форматирования (цвет, шрифт, границы)|Проверить результат на тестовых данных-->

Тип правила Пример использования Формула (если нужна)
Выделение ячеек Подсветка продаж выше 100 000 ₽
Гистограммы Визуализация прогресса выполнения плана
Цветовые шкалы Градиент от зелёного (максимум) до красного (минимум)
Формула Выделение просроченных дат =СЕГОДНЯ()>B1

3. Работа с цветовыми схемами и темами

Если вы часто работаете с корпоративными отчётами, настройка тематической палитры сэкономит время. Excel позволяет сохранять наборы цветов и применять их к новым документам.

Как создать собственную тему:

  • 🖥️ Перейдите на вкладку Макет (или Дизайн в Excel 2016+) → ЦветаНастроить цвета.
  • 🎨 Измените цвета для каждого элемента (текст, фон, акценты) — они будут использоваться в диаграммах и таблицах.
  • 💾 Сохраните тему через ТемыСохранить текущую тему (файл с расширением .thmx).

Excel автоматически подбирает контрастные цвета для текста при изменении фона ячейки, но это работает только для стандартной палитры. Если вы используете кастомные оттенки, проверяйте читаемость вручную — особенно при печати.

Совет: для презентаций используйте цвета из логотипа компании. Чтобы точно подобрать оттенок, воспользуйтесь бесплатными сервисами вроде ColorZilla (расширение для браузера), которое определяет HEX-код любого пикселя на экране.

4. Градиенты и узоры: нестандартное оформление

Для визуализации данных полезно использовать градиентную заливку. Например, в отчётах о продажах можно показать динамику от тёмно-зелёного (высокие продажи) до светло-красного (низкие).

Как создать градиент:

  1. Выделите диапазон.
  2. Нажмите ГлавнаяУсловное форматированиеЦветовые шкалы.
  3. Выберите готовую шкалу или настройте свою (Другие правила).

Для статичных таблиц (не связанных с данными) можно использовать узоры заливки:

  • Правый клик по ячейке → Формат ячеек → вкладка Заливка.
  • В разделе Узор выберите тип (полоски, сетка, точки) и цвета для фона/узора.
⚠️ Внимание: Узоры заливки не отображаются при экспорте таблицы в PDF в некоторых версиях Excel. Перед отправкой отчёта проверьте предварительный просмотр печати (ФайлПечать).

5. Проблемы с цветами: почему Excel игнорирует настройки

Иногда цвета в Excel ведут себя непредсказуемо: не печатаются, отображаются иначе или сбрасываются. Рассмотрим типичные причины и решения:

Проблема Причина Решение
Цвета не печатаются Настройка Чёрно-белая печать в параметрах принтера ФайлПечатьНастройки принтера → снимите галочку с Чёрно-белая
Цвета отличаются на экране и при печати Профиль цвета принтера не совпадает с RGB на мониторе Используйте CMYK-палитру для корпоративных цветов или калибруйте монитор
Условное форматирование не работает Формат ячеек установлен как Текст Измените формат на Общий или Числовой

Ещё одна распространённая ошибка — конфликт форматов. Если ячейка имеет и условное форматирование, и ручную заливку, приоритет отдаётся последнему применённому правилу. Чтобы это исправить:

  1. Выделите проблемный диапазон.
  2. Нажмите ГлавнаяУсловное форматированиеУправление правилами.
  3. Отсортируйте правила по приоритету (кнопка Вверх/Вниз).
Почему в сводных таблицах не работают цвета?

Сводные таблицы имеют собственные настройки форматирования, которые перекрывают обычные правила. Чтобы применить цвета:

1. Кликните правой кнопкой по сводной таблице → Настройки полей значенийДополнительные параметры.

2. Выберите Показать значения какФорматирование по правилам.

3. Настройте условное форматирование непосредственно для сводной таблицы.

6. Продвинутые техники: цвета через VBA и Power Query

Для автоматизации работы с цветами в больших таблицах используйте макросы VBA или Power Query. Например, следующий код окрасит ячейки в столбце A в зависимости от значения:

Sub ColorCellsByValue()

Dim rng As Range

Dim cell As Range

Set rng = Range("A1:A100")

For Each cell In rng

If cell.Value > 100 Then

cell.Interior.Color = RGB(146, 208, 80) ' Зелёный

ElseIf cell.Value < 50 Then

cell.Interior.Color = RGB(255, 192, 0) ' Оранжевый

End If

Next cell

End Sub

В Power Query можно добавлять столбцы с цветовыми метками на основе условий. Например, для пометки строк с отрицательными значениями:

  1. Загрузите данные в Power Query (ДанныеИз таблицы/диапазона).
  2. Добавьте пользовательский столбец с формулой:
if [Столбец1] < 0 then "Красный" else "Зелёный"
  1. После загрузки данных назад в Excel примените условное форматирование по новому столбцу.
⚠️ Внимание: Макросы VBA отключены по умолчанию в файлах .xlsx по соображениям безопасности. Чтобы их использовать, сохраните файл как .xlsm (с поддержкой макросов) и включите выполнение скриптов в ФайлПараметрыЦентр управления безопасностью.

7. Сохранение и перенос цветовых настроек

Если вы создали идеальную таблицу с цветами, её настройки можно перенести в другие файлы. Вот как это сделать:

  • 📁 Копирование формата: используйте Формат по образцу (кисть на вкладке Главная), чтобы перенести цвета и шрифты на другой лист или книгу.
  • 🖼️ Экспорт тем: сохраните тему (.thmx) и загрузите её в новый файл через ДизайнТемыОбзор тем.
  • 📊 Шаблоны таблиц: преобразуйте диапазон в Таблицу Excel (Ctrl+T), затем сохраните как шаблон (.xltx). При создании новой таблицы цвета будут подгружаться автоматически.

Для переноса условного форматирования между файлами:

  1. Откройте оба файла.
  2. В исходном файле скопируйте ячейки с правилами (Ctrl+C).
  3. В целевом файле выделите диапазон и выберите Специальная вставкаФорматы.

Совет: если вы часто работаете с одними и теми же цветами, создайте пользовательский стиль ячейки:

  1. Отформатируйте ячейку (цвет, шрифт, границы).
  2. Нажмите ГлавнаяСтилиСоздать стиль ячейки.
  3. Дайте стилю имя (например, Заголовок отчёта) и сохраните.

Теперь этот стиль будет доступен во всех новых файлах Excel на вашем компьютере.

Часто задаваемые вопросы

Можно ли в Excel использовать прозрачность для цветов?

Да, но с ограничениями. В ручной заливке ячеек прозрачность недоступна, но её можно эмулировать:

  1. Используйте узоры заливки (например, серые точки на белом фоне).
  2. Для диаграмм настройте прозрачность через Формат областиЗаливкаПолупрозрачность.
  3. В Excel 365 доступны векторные фигуры с настраиваемой прозрачностью (вкладка ВставкаФигуры).
Как скопировать цвет из одной ячейки в другую без форматирования?

Если нужно перенести только цвет заливки, а не всё форматирование:

  1. Выделите ячейку-источник.
  2. Нажмите Ctrl+C (скопировать).
  3. Выделите целевую ячейку.
  4. Нажмите Ctrl+Alt+VФорматыOK.

Если нужно перенести только цвет текста, используйте Кисть форматирования (кликните по ней дважды, затем выделите целевые ячейки).

Почему при экспорте в PDF цвета становятся тусклыми?

Это связано с настройками цветопередачи принтера. Решения:

  • В меню печати (ФайлПечать) выберите Microsoft Print to PDF вместо физического принтера.
  • Откройте Параметры страницыЛист → установите Качество печати на Максимум.
  • Если используете корпоративный принтер, обратитесь в IT-службу для настройки цветового профиля.
Как сделать так, чтобы цвет ячейки менялся при выборе значения из выпадающего списка?

Это реализуется через условное форматирование с формулой:

  1. Создайте выпадающий список (ДанныеПроверка данных).
  2. Выделите ячейки с списком.
  3. Создайте правило условного форматирования с формулой вида:
=A1="Да"

и задайте зелёный цвет заливки. Для значения "Нет" создайте отдельное правило с красным цветом.

Можно ли импортировать цвета из Photoshop или Illustrator в Excel?

Прямого импорта нет, но есть обходные пути:

  • Скопируйте HEX-код цвета в Photoshop (Правый клик по палитреКопировать цвет).
  • В Excel выберите Другие цветаОпределить цвет и вставьте HEX-код.
  • Для палитры используйте сервисы вроде Coolors или Adobe Color, чтобы экспортировать цвета в формате, совместимом с Excel.